Output fd98e20efd668563d5187290553a9a75c607aa02b3872d00af3e1eb412b645ba:0

value
140000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09c9ecfb27b6038a27ae3d561307c33be405e5c8 OP_EQUAL
address
32amuKBgJUoewuX8zShgVXu7Cp1BDLUaaY
transaction
fd98e20efd668563d5187290553a9a75c607aa02b3872d00af3e1eb412b645ba
confirmations
319231
spent
true